What is the greatest common divisor of 44 and 20?
Understanding numbers can reveal smart financial habits. Take the question: what is the greatest common divisor of 44 and 20? The answer is 4, because 4 is the largest number that divides both evenly. ```How many divisors does the number 44 have?

The divisors of a number are simply the integers that divide that number without leaving a remainder. For 44, the divisors are 1, 2, 4, 11, 22, and 44. So, the number 44 has a total of six divisors.
